This planned tender for metal detection equipment is well-structured with clear lots and a defined scope. However, it is in a pre-procurement stage, leading to some missing details regarding technical specifications and evaluation criteria.
The tender is in a 'planned' status, indicating it is pre-publication. While the procedure is 'competitive flexible procedure', specific details are absent. The CPV code is provided, and there are no immediate indications of disputes. The deadlines provided are for an Expression of Interest, not the final submission, which is a common practice for planned tenders. The final submission deadline is quite far out, which is reasonable.
The description clearly outlines the need for metal detection equipment, including archways, handheld wands, and poles, and specifies the intended use within the HMPPS estate. The division into three lots is well-defined. However, the statement that 'Lots and details of technical specifications for equipment are liable to change' introduces some ambiguity.
Basic information such as title, reference, organization, estimated value, and contract duration are present. The Expression of Interest deadline and a link to the form are provided. However, crucial details like the full tender publication date and the actual tender submission deadline are missing from the provided text, and the tender documents themselves are not accessible with content.
The tender is open, and the estimated value is disclosed. The division into lots allows for broader participation. The requirement for bidders to be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) is a specific constraint that could limit competition, but it is clearly stated and justified by the nature of the requirement. The Expression of Interest process is transparent.
An Expression of Interest can be submitted electronically via a provided URL. The contract duration and start date are specified. However, the lack of a clear tender publication date and the absence of detailed financing information or a clear e-submission process for the final tender submission limit practicality at this stage.
Key fields like title, reference, organization, estimated value, and contract duration are populated. The dates provided for the Expression of Interest are logical. The tender status is 'planned', which aligns with the pre-publication information. There are no indications of suspension or disputes.
There is no explicit mention of green procurement, social aspects, or innovation within the provided tender information. The tender is not indicated as EU funded.
